| General News: The 25th Annual Gemini Award Nominations Announced |
| Posted
on Tuesday, August 31, 2010 - 08:43 AM |
The Academy of Canadian Cinema & Television is pleased to announce the nominations for the 25th Annual Gemini Awards, recognizing the year’s best in Canadian English-language television. This year’s celebrations will be held in Toronto over three nights in November. The Industry Gala Presentations will take place on Tuesday November 2nd and Wednesday November 3rd at the Kool Haus Entertainment Complex; the Broadcast Gala will take place on Saturday November 13th at the historic Winter Garden Theatre and will be broadcast live-to-tape on Global and Showcase.

| Ratings: Here’s the Situation – JERSEY SHORE Attracts a Record Number of Fist Pumpers on MTV |
| Posted
on Monday, August 30, 2010 - 09:29 AM |
Thursday nights are reserved for GTL and MTV. Last Thursday’s episode of the hit series JERSEY SHORE attracted more viewers than ever, ranking the second largest audience for a single episode in MTV’s history, hitting a total audience of 486,000 and 362,000 in P12-34.* This season also hits fist pump worthy numbers online. JERSEY SHORE has been the #1 video for the CTV online network over the last four weeks, with this season already hitting nearly seven million video views on mtv.ca.** Thursday night’s broadcast won primetime, garnering the largest audience on Canadian and US non-sports specialty networks. New episodes of JERSEY SHORE air Thursdays at 10 p.m. ET/PT on MTV. Viewers can also watch episodes on mtv.ca.

| Programming Highlights: HANI and SHELAINA are the First Two Dancers Eliminated From So You Think You Can Dance Canada |
| Posted
on Tuesday, August 24, 2010 - 09:06 PM |
Following last night’s announcement that Shelaina Anderson, 19, a Contemporary dancer from Edmonton, AB, suffered an injury during rehearsals and was unable to perform, it was revealed tonight that she has withdrawn from the competition and is therefore one of the eliminated competitors. Also eliminated tonight was her original partner HANI Abaza, 26, a Modern Contemporary dancer from Ottawa, who danced a Jazz number with last-minute substitute partner SO YOU THINK YOU CAN DANCE CANADA Season 2 winner, Tara-Jean Popowich.
